A build toolchain may override CPPFLAGS on the command line of "make".
Doing so currently breaks libsepol/tests compilation, as it requires
"-I../include/ -I$(CHECKPOLICY)" to be provided in gcc's arguments.
This completes commit 15f2740733 ("Makefiles: override *FLAGS and
*LIBS").
